The surface viscous liquid is one of fishs resistance reduction elements. The fish surface is covered with viscous liquid,
which is considered to reduce the resistance. As compared with a solvent, a certain polymer solution of several ppm to
several hundred ppm offers substantially reduced turbulent frictional resistance. The relationship between the Toms
effect and reduction of viscosity resistance is described. The purpose of this research is to study the drag reduction in
resistance of catamaran model by slime monepterus albus solution in wall. The catamaran model with hull L = 1.8 m, B
= 0.32m and T = 0.12 m pulled by electric motor which the motor speed can be varied. The ship model resistance is
measured by load cell anemometer. The difference of friction coefficient is expressed as a reduction in friction drag. The
results shows the drag reduction about 4 -7%.
Keyword: dilute biopolymer slime monepterus, drag reduction, catamaran model.
2. EXPERIMENTAL DESCRIPTIONS
A series of model tests were conducted in a basin. The
basin had a length of 50 m and width of 10 m, and the
water depth was maintained at a constant depth of 2 m.
The experiments were conducted for a Froude number of
up to 0.6. The model was connected to the load cell
transducer at a point located amidships and vertically
above the base line, allowing the model to move freely in
the vertical plane. Total resistance was measured for each
run over the test range of Froude numbers. In the
resistance tests, the ship model was pulled by a wire rope
and the total longitudinal force acting on the model was
